So if I'm trying to get a pet from somebody and it says that I can trade it for 1.5 non or 15kg, what exactly does that mean and how can I trade for it?

Hiya! So the term "non" comes from the old list, which basically meant a pet worth the same as a non-tag dog or a non-ballon dog. The list has been discontinued since then, but we still use terms like non and ma from back then as easy reference guides for worths! Horror has a pretty great explanation of what it means here:
Forum/viewtopic.php?f=20&t=4899188#p142982114 So for this trade if the person is looking for 1.5 nons of value, thats the equivalent of about 3000 c$. As for kg thats actually a term used in reference to a site called Flight Rising, which a lot of users here on CS also play. They have two currencies over there, gems and treasure. Theres always a pretty stable conversion of gems/treasure to c$ so cross trading happens a lot. In this case, this person is looking for 15k (15,000) gems, which is about 3000 c$ when converted.
